Program II: soprano, violin, cello, and piano
Join The Chicago Ensemble for its 42nd season of eclectic classical chamber music performances, featuring Gerald Rizzer, artistic director/piano, and leading Chicago artists. Every concert offers a wide-ranging program of beloved masterworks, rarely heard gems, and contemporary works by composers around the world. Enjoy an intimate setting, complimentary reception, and informal spoken program notes that provide the perfect chamber music experience.
